New Delhi, November 18, 2009: Centre for Science and Environment (CSE) has welcomed the newly notified Revised National Ambient Air Quality Standards, which were announced here today by Jairam Ramesh, the minister of state (independent charge) for environment and forests.
CSE questions recently released environment ministry report on air pollution sources, uncovers serious fallacies in it
The Union ministry of environment and forests has released a new six-city report on air pollution sources, titled ‘Air quality monitoring, emission inventory and source apportionment study for Indian cities’.
